kwpescn43069A firm currently uses 40,000 workers to produce 180,000 units of output per day. The daily wage per worker is $100, and the price of the firm's output is $28. The cost of other variable inputs is $500,000 per day. (Note: Assume that output is constant at the level of 180,000 units per day.)
Assume that total fixed cost equals $1,200,000. Calculate the values for the following four formulas:
- Total Variable Cost = (Number of Workers x Worker’s Daily Wage) + Other Variable Costs
- Total Costs = Total Variable Costs + Total Fixed Costs
- Total Revenue = Price * Quantity
- Average Variable Cost = Total Variable Cost / Units of Output per Day
- Average Total Cost = (Total Variable Cost + Total Fixed Cost) / Units of Output per Day
Complete the following:
- Calculate the firm’s profit or loss. Is the firm making a profit or a loss?
- Explain the Short Run Shut Down Rule. Should this firm shut down? Please explain.
